In the Report of the Constitutional Commission 1968 appeared the following:
“We therefore recommend that the new constitution should contain a brief, factual preamble and, by a majority of four to one, that it should include an acknowledgement of the authority and guidance of Almighty God.” (Para 603)
One Commissioner thought that some would regard a reference to God in the Constitution as being out of place.
This is very interesting and it is perhaps astonishing that so little attention was focussed upon the questions arising. I believe in some sort of higher authority but I would not be so bold as to say that Almighty God is an indisputable fact!
